Singapore Airport Taxi Service

Following your arrival in the modern mega-city of Singapore, you’ll likely want to get to your hotel quickly so you can start exploring. Taking a Singapore Airport taxi ensures a fast and direct trip, without the hassle of finding public transport stations or navigating complex timetables.

You can take a cab from any of Singapore Airport’s four passenger terminals at any time of day, as taxis operate 24/7. The ride from the Singapore Airport taxi rank to the city takes around 20 minutes, while those heading to the nearby island of Sentosa should allow about 25 minutes for the journey.

Singapore Airport taxi rates

Singapore taxi fares from the airport follow regulated pricing and are calculated using the cab’s taximeter. Because of this, the price of each fare will be different based on your destination and the level of traffic. Additionally, there are extra charges in place depending on the time of day the driver picks up a passenger, which can increase the price of a fare.

The final cost of the fare will be determined by several factors, such as the vehicle you use, the time of day, and where you’re going. All taxi rides in Singapore start with a base fare of €2.80 (SGD 4.10) regardless of the vehicle type, and then an additional €0.40 (SGD 0.60) is charged for every km up to 10 km. After 10 km, this increases to €0.50 (SGD 0.70).

Moreover, from 00:00 to 06:00, all fares increase by 50% regardless of the day, and extra charges of 25% apply for passengers traveling during peak hours. Furthermore, all journeys are subject to an additional fee of €5.50 (SGD 8) when departing between 17:00 and 23:59, and €4.10 (SGD 6) outside of these times.

Taxis from Singapore Airport are available in all styles, including standard sedans with space for up to 3 people, premium options for up to 7, as well as luxury rides like limousines for 3 people.

The average Singapore Airport taxi cost to the city is roughly between €15.90 (SGD 23.80) and €23.20 (SGD 34.80), while the journey to Sentosa starts from €19.40 (SGD 29) during the day and €28.50 (SGD 42.70) at night. If you want to visit Johor Bahru, expect to pay around €26.90 (SGD 40.30) by day or €39.70 (SGD 59.50) after dark for a taxi from Singapore Airport.

Where to get a Singapore Airport taxi?

All four of Singapore Airport’s passenger terminals have their own taxi rank located outside the Arrivals Hall, each with a booth where passengers can get a ride 24/7. The airport’s taxis come in different colors depending on the company, with yellow and silver being among the most common. Because Singapore Airport is so busy, you may have to wait for a cab for some time, particularly at nighttime or during the early morning hours.

Useful tips for getting a taxi from Singapore Airport

  1. Traffic levels on the way into the city from Changi can be unpredictable, but booking a taxi from Singapore Airport to your hotel ensures a set fee, without having to worry about metered fares.
  2. Most drivers have an understanding of English in Singapore, making it easy to communicate with your driver, but be sure to have a copy of your address just in case.
  3. Paying for your Singapore Airport taxi with credit card is possible in most cases, but some drivers may not accept it, so it's best to exchange some Singapore Dollars to cover yourself.
  4. In accordance with national law, all passengers must wear a seatbelt in Singapore Airport taxis for safety.
  5. If you're traveling in a large group, it's advised to pre-book your ride, as you might otherwise be stuck waiting for long periods.
  6. Always ask your driver for a receipt before you exit the vehicle, as it can be useful if you lose belongings or need to file a complaint.
  7. Ensure your driver doesn't depart without resetting the taximeter, or you could be overcharged.
  8. Tipping for an airport taxi in Singapore isn't required, though some passengers choose to leave a 10% tip when they receive excellent service.

Frequently asked questions

How much is a taxi from Singapore Airport?

The price of a taxi service from Singapore Airport depends on the distance to your hotel and the route the driver takes, as fares are calculated per km. Passengers can expect to pay between €17 (SGD 25) and €30 (SGD 45), depending on the time of day.

Can I get a taxi at Singapore Airport?

You can easily get a taxi from Singapore Airport as soon as you land. Each terminal has its own designated taxi rank, with signs in the Arrivals Hall directing you where to go. If you prefer not to wait, you can also pre-book an airport taxi in advance.

How to get taxi in Singapore Airport?

After landing and collecting your bags, head to the Arrivals Hall and look for the sign directing you to the exit. This will lead you to the Singapore Airport taxi rank, where a member of staff at the booth will arrange a cab for you.
